Position Summary
Build a rewarding career that supports research, patient care, and education initiatives through fundraising for Health Sciences Development (HSD). This position supports the Executive Director, Hospital Initiatives with responsibilities spanning an array of UCLA Health programs within the Hospital Initiatives portfolio and is a great opportunity to learn about fundraising and develop your career goals through our training, mentoring, and professional development programs. As a Fundraising Coordinator with our HSD Hospital Initiatives team, you will provide development support across a portfolio that includes Integrative Medicine Collaborative programs such as Operation Mend, Sound Body Sound Mind, the Center for East-West Medicine, Music Therapy, and the People-Animal Connection, as well as Emergency and Space Medicine, Nursing, and Palliative Care. Primary Responsibilities
As a Fundraising Coordinator, you will build meaningful relationships with donors and colleagues by assisting with event and travel planning, scheduling meetings, drafting correspondence, responding to inquiries, and managing information. Our team is committed to excellent customer service that creates positive relationships and experiences for our donors, faculty, staff, alumni and other key constituents. Qualifications
1. Ability to learn and deliver customer service skills such as interacting in a friendly, professional manner and responding quickly and appropriately to requests.
2.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
3. Ability to exercise independent judgment, take initiative, be resourceful and make decisions.
4. Ability to research, gather, analyze, and synthesize information from sources such as online searches, databases and files.
5. Excellent interpersonal skills to develop and maintain collaborative working relationships.
6. Ability to work as part of a team, be detail oriented, organized and meet deadlines.
7. Ability to maintain confidentiality and to use discretion.
8. Proficiency with business software such as Google docs, Google forms, Word, Excel, and Outlook, and databases.
9. Must be able maintain a reliable and predictable work schedule including ability to work occasional evenings and/or weekends as needed.
